2. Deconstructing a Typical Question: Observational Drawing | 分解典型问题:观察绘画
One of the most frequent tasks in past papers is an observational drawing question, such as ‘Draw a crushed can or a pair of shoes showing a range of tones and textures.’ Examiners are checking for accurate proportions, the use of shading to create form, and attention to surface details. Begin by lightly sketching the overall shape using basic geometric forms, then gradually refine contours. Build up tone gradually from mid-tones to deep shadows, and use a putty rubber to lift out highlights—this shows a sophisticated command of the medium.

3. Analysing Artistic Elements: Colour Theory in Past Papers | 分析艺术元素:历年试卷中的色彩理论
Colour theory questions often ask you to create a colour wheel or describe the mood of a painting based on its palette. A common past-paper prompt is: ‘Explain how the artist has used warm and cool colours to create a sense of depth in the landscape.’ To score full marks, mention specific colours like ‘burnt sienna’, ‘ultramarine’, or ‘cadmium yellow’, and link them to spatial effects—warm colours appear to advance, while cool colours recede. Using terms such as ‘complementary colours’ (opposites on the colour wheel) and ‘analogous colours’ (neighbours) demonstrates subject knowledge.

4. Composition and Perspective: Recurring Themes | 构图与透视:反复出现的主题
Questions about composition frequently appear, such as ‘Describe how the artist has arranged shapes to guide the viewer’s eye.’ Look for leading lines, the rule of thirds, and focal points. In perspective tasks—’Draw a corridor in one-point perspective’—you must correctly plot the horizon line and vanishing point. All orthogonal lines should converge at that single point. Past papers reward students who can also explain why the artist might have chosen a low eye level to make the scene feel monumental, or a high eye level to convey overview and vulnerability.

5. Artist Research Questions: How to Structure Your Response | 艺术家研究问题:如何组织你的回答
A classic past-paper question is: ‘Select a work by [artist name] and analyse how they have used line, tone, and texture to convey meaning.’ Structure your response in three clear paragraphs: first, briefly describe the artwork and its title; second, use the ‘SEE’ method (State the technique, give an Example, Explain the effect); third, link the formal elements to the mood or message. For instance, ‘Van Gogh’s expressive, swirling brushstrokes in Starry Night create a sense of emotional turbulence and movement, reflecting his inner turmoil.’ Always include your own informed opinion.

6. Contextual Studies: Linking Art to History and Culture | 语境研究:将艺术与历史和文化联系起来
Many Year 8 papers include a question on context: ‘Explain how the social or historical background of the time influenced this painting.’ If the image is a Pop Art piece, discuss 1960s consumerism and mass media; if it is a Cubist work, mention early 20th-century shifts in how reality was perceived after Einstein’s theories. Examiners want you to show that art does not exist in a vacuum. Even a simple sentence like ‘The use of bold, optimistic colours in post-war Mondrian reflects the desire for a new, orderly society’ can lift your marks.

7. Design Problem-Solving: Creating a Final Piece | 设计问题解决:创作最终作品
Exam papers often present a design brief: ‘Design a poster for an environmental campaign using a monochromatic colour scheme.’ Your process should show divergent thinking: generate 4–6 quick thumbnail sketches exploring different compositions and symbols. Then, select one to develop, annotating why you chose it based on design principles like contrast and balance. The final piece must be neat, with controlled application of media. Using tracing paper to refine the composition before transferring to the final paper is a technique high-achievers frequently adopt.

8. Annotation and Reflection: The Power of Words | 注释与反思:文字的力量
Examiners consistently report that strong annotation separates high grades from average ones. When describing your own work in a portfolio or exam, avoid simple phrases like ‘I like this’. Instead, use critical vocabulary: ‘I have used cross-hatching to create a dense shadow under the apple, which anchors it within the composition.’ Reflect on what worked and what you would improve. A common reflective question in past papers is: ‘If you were to repeat this task, what would you change and why?’ Your answer here shows your development as an artist.

10.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them | 常见错误及如何避免
Past paper examiner reports highlight several recurring pitfalls. One is the ‘floating object’ syndrome in observational studies—drawing a still life without any indication of a surface or cast shadow, making it appear disconnected. Always draw the table edge and a faint cast shadow. Another mistake is forgetting to annotate sketches during the exam, which loses valuable AO3 marks. Additionally, many students present a final piece that looks almost identical to their source artist’s work rather than transforming it into something original. Use the artist’s style as a springboard, not a template.

11. Time Management Strategies for Art Exams | 艺术考试的时间管理策略
A two-hour exam can feel rushed, but past papers indicate that 20 minutes for planning, 90 minutes for production, and 10 minutes for final touches and annotation is a proven formula. In those first 20 minutes, read the brief three times, underline key words like ‘texture’, ‘warm colours’, or ‘cultural identity’, and draw at least four thumbnail sketches with notes. Set a timer on your watch—not the classroom clock—to keep track. If a section is taking too long, pause and move on; you can always come back if you have used a pencil that can be erased or adapted.

12. Enhancing Creativity: Beyond the Expected Answer | 提升创意:超越预期答案
To achieve the highest bands, your work must demonstrate creative risk-taking which can be informed by past paper trends. When a question asks for a ‘response to nature’, most students draw a leaf or a flower. But consider exploring the microscopic patterns of a leaf cell or the rhythmic movement of a flock of birds in flight—unexpected viewpoints signal a conceptual leap. Using mixed media in a controlled way, such as combining watercolour washes with fine liner pen, adds depth. Past high-scorers often present their process as a visual journey, including pictures of failed experiments with comments on what they learned, which fulfils AO2 beautifully.
